In her final daily column at the Philadelphia Inquirer, veteran tv writer Gail Shister signs off in typical Shister fashion, promising that "[her] show isn't being cancelled. It's moving to a new timeslot."**
And in her last entry, Gail reminds us how different things were when she initially took the reins back in 1982. Back before Vanna White's first eyelift, when Tom Brokaw was just another backup anchor and "Bette Davis Eyes" (i.e. as opposed to "Bootylicious") was considered a chart-topper.
We'll miss Gail Shister's daily primetime musings, her plucky penchant for cable broadcasting programs, and her encyclopedic knowledge of shows like "Gunsmoke," that ran well before we were even born. Congratulations on a job well done, Gail. We'll definitely be tuning in for the sequel.
Which is clever, because it's about tv. Which just happens to be Gail's area of expertise!
